Afd Employees Approach "Faz" Photographers in the Bundestag, Weidel Apologizes

Summary by focus.de
Last Thursday there was an incident in the Bundestag. A photographer from the "Frankfurter Allgemeine Zeitung" took pictures of Alice Weidl – after that two employees of the AfD head of the AfD approached the photographer.
